Re: 24 fps ... AE and Vegas
This one looks reasonable simple
1: Check the moho presets - are you animating on 24 or 25, or 30.
2: Most people animation on 25 or 30, (Europe and USA respectively).
3: Vegas can be set to 24, 25, 30, 50 and 60 - assuming you are working with the later ones designed to handle 1080 HDTV.
The small lag seems that moho is on 25 and the edit suites are on 24.
This should help track which package is on the wrong time signature.
